| /** Gets gravity vector |
| * @param[out] data gravity vector in body frame scaled such that 1.0 = 2^30. |
| * @return Returns INV_SUCCESS if successful or an error code if not. |
| */ |
| inv_error_t inv_get_gravity(long *data) |
| { |
| data[0] = |
| inv_q29_mult(rh.nav_quat[1], rh.nav_quat[3]) - inv_q29_mult(rh.nav_quat[2], rh.nav_quat[0]); |
| data[1] = |
| inv_q29_mult(rh.nav_quat[2], rh.nav_quat[3]) + inv_q29_mult(rh.nav_quat[1], rh.nav_quat[0]); |
| data[2] = |
| (inv_q29_mult(rh.nav_quat[3], rh.nav_quat[3]) + inv_q29_mult(rh.nav_quat[0], rh.nav_quat[0])) - |
| 1073741824L; |
| |
| return INV_SUCCESS; |
| } |
| |
| /** Returns a quaternion based only on gyro and accel. |
| * @param[out] data 6-axis gyro and accel quaternion scaled such that 1.0 = 2^30. |
| * @return Returns INV_SUCCESS if successful or an error code if not. |
| */ |
| inv_error_t inv_get_6axis_quaternion(long *data) |
| { |
| memcpy(data, rh.gam_quat, sizeof(rh.gam_quat)); |
| return INV_SUCCESS; |
| } |
| |
| /** Returns a quaternion. |
| * @param[out] data 9-axis quaternion scaled such that 1.0 = 2^30. |
| * @return Returns INV_SUCCESS if successful or an error code if not. |
| */ |
| inv_error_t inv_get_quaternion(long *data) |
| { |
| if (rh.status & (INV_COMPASS_CORRECTION_SET | INV_6_AXIS_QUAT_SET)) { |
| inv_q_mult(rh.compass_correction, rh.gam_quat, rh.nav_quat); |
| rh.status &= ~(INV_COMPASS_CORRECTION_SET | INV_6_AXIS_QUAT_SET); |
| } |
| memcpy(data, rh.nav_quat, sizeof(rh.nav_quat)); |
| return INV_SUCCESS; |
| } |

| /** |
| * @brief Returns 3-element vector of accelerometer data in body frame |
| * with gravity removed |
| * @param[out] data 3-element vector of accelerometer data in body frame |
| * with gravity removed |
| * @return INV_SUCCESS if successful |
| * INV_ERROR_INVALID_PARAMETER if invalid input pointer |
| */ |
| inv_error_t inv_get_linear_accel(long *data) |
| { |
| long gravity[3]; |
| |
| if (data != NULL) |
| { |
| inv_get_accel_set(data, NULL, NULL); |
| inv_get_gravity(gravity); |
| data[0] -= gravity[0] >> 14; |
| data[1] -= gravity[1] >> 14; |
| data[2] -= gravity[2] >> 14; |
| return INV_SUCCESS; |
| } |
| else { |
| return INV_ERROR_INVALID_PARAMETER; |
| } |
| } |
